Ինչպե՞ս կարող եմ գաղտնագրել SQL պահպանված ընթացակարգը:
Ինչպե՞ս կարող եմ գաղտնագրել SQL պահպանված ընթացակարգը:

Video: Ինչպե՞ս կարող եմ գաղտնագրել SQL պահպանված ընթացակարգը:

Video: Ինչպե՞ս կարող եմ գաղտնագրել SQL պահպանված ընթացակարգը:
Video: Հեռացնել կոդավորումը SQL Server շտեմարանի հեշտությամբ օբյեկտներից 2024, Նոյեմբեր
Anonim

Դեպի ծածկագրել ա պահված կարգը պարզապես անհրաժեշտ է օգտագործել WITH-ը ԿՈՂԾԱԳՐՈՒՄ տարբերակը՝ CREATE-ի հետ միասին ԿԱՐԳԸ սցենար. Ստորև բերված է ստեղծման օրինակ պահված ընթացակարգեր մեկի հետ կոդավորումը իսկ մյուսը՝ առանց կոդավորումը . Այժմ գործարկեք sp_helptext-ը պահված ընթացակարգեր -ի սկզբնական կոդը տեսնելու համար ընթացակարգը.

Այս առնչությամբ, ինչպե՞ս կարող եմ վերծանել կոդավորված SQL Server-ի պահպանված ընթացակարգը:

Տեղադրվելուց հետո SQL Ապակոդավորիչ, վերծանում այնպիսի առարկա, ինչպիսին ա պահված - ընթացակարգը արագ և պարզ է: Սկսելու համար բացեք SQL Ապակոդավորիչ և միացեք դրան SQL Server օրինակ, որը պարունակում է տվյալների բազան կոդավորված պահված - ընթացակարգերը դու ուզում ես վերծանել . Այնուհետև թերթեք դեպի պահված - ընթացակարգը հարցականի տակ.

Նմանապես, ինչպե՞ս կարող եմ դիտել պահված ընթացակարգը SQL Server հարցումում:

  1. Object Explorer-ում միացեք տվյալների բազայի շարժիչի օրինակին:
  2. Գործիքադարակի վրա սեղմեք Նոր հարցում:
  3. Հարցման պատուհանում մուտքագրեք հետևյալ հայտարարությունները, որոնք օգտագործում են sys. sql_modules կատալոգի դիտում: Փոխեք տվյալների բազայի անվանումը և պահպանված ընթացակարգի անվանումը, որպեսզի հղում կատարեք ձեր ուզած տվյալների բազային և պահպանված ընթացակարգին:

Նաև գիտեք, արդյոք SQL-ը կոդավորված է:

Երբ դուք իրականացնում եք SQL Սերվերի թափանցիկ տվյալներ Կոդավորումը (TDE) the կոդավորումը տվյալների բազան իրականացվում է SQL Սերվեր ինքնին: EKM Մատակարարը պաշտպանում է սիմետրիկությունը կոդավորումը բանալին օգտագործվում է TDE-ի կողմից, բայց կոդավորումը (սովորաբար AES) իրականացվում է SQL Սերվեր, օգտագործելով Microsoft-ը կոդավորումը գրադարաններ։

Ի՞նչ է DAC SQL սերվերը:

Այն SQL նվիրված ադմինիստրատորի միացում ( DAC ) ի վեր գոյություն ունի SQL 2005 թ. և ախտորոշիչ կապ է, որը նախատեսված է թույլ տալու ադմինիստրատորին լուծել անսարքությունները SQL Server երբ օրինակը խնդիրներ ունի. Միայն sysadmin դերի անդամները կարող են միանալ՝ օգտագործելով DAC.

Խորհուրդ ենք տալիս: